Thai Chicken Burger
Course:
Dinner
Ingredients
Patties
- 450 grams Turkey Mince (or chicken thigh mince)
- 3 cloves Garlic (minced)
- 3 Spring Onion (sliced)
- 1 JalapeƱo (diced)
- 1 tablespoon Soy Sauce
- 1 Lime (juiced)
- 1⁄4 teaspoons Salt
- 1⁄4 teaspoons Black Pepper
- 1 teaspoon Sugar
- Coriander (fresh)
Slaw
- 3 tablespoons Peanut Butter (creamy)
- 1 Lime (juiced)
- 1 teaspoon Sugar
- 15 millilitres White Vinegar
- 10 millilitres Soy Sauce
- 6 grams Sriracha (1tsp or chilli sauce)
- 15 millilitres Water
- 0.25 Red Cabbage (same amount as carrot)
- 1 Carrot (grated)
Burgers
- 3 Burger Buns
Notes
Serve with edamame.
Steps
Patties:
- Preheat the oven to 180C fan with cast iron pan inside.
- Add all the ingredients for the chicken patties to a bowl and mix.
- Form into 3 burger patties with your hands.
- Transfer the cast iron to the hob and heat over high heat (10 or 11).
- Once up to temperature, add 1 tbsp peanut oil and wait for it to heat up.
- Place the burger patties in the pan and cook 2-3 mins per side (until golden brown).
- Transfer to a small aluminium tray and place in the oven for 10 minutes until internal temperature is 73C.
Slaw:
- Whisk together the peanut butter, lime juice, sugar, white vinegar, soy sauce, sriracha, and water.
- Add the cabbage and carrots and mix.
Burgers:
- Toast the buns lightly until golden brown.
- Add patty.
- Top with slaw.
